A method of two-threshold expectation maximum and Markov random field is presented to automatic detection of terrain surface changes after the Wenchuan earthquake, on May 12, 2008, using multitemporal ALOS PALSAR images. As an example in the Beichuan area, three kinds of terrain surface changes, i.e., scattering enhanced, reduced, and no-changed, are automatically detected and classified. By using...
